Hidden Value in Battery Chemistry Selection
Most people don't realize that battery energy storage systems aren't one-size-fits-all. Lithium iron phosphate (LFP) vs nickel manganese cobalt (NMC)? The right choice depends on discharge cycles, climate, and even local fire codes. A good partner would've prevented that embarrassing (and expensive) casino project in Vegas – turns out their NMC batteries couldn't handle 115°F garage temperatures!

Choosing Partners That Deliver ROI
But how do you avoid greenwashing charlatans? Three litmus tests:
1. Technology Agnosticism: Beware partners pushing one vendor's products. The best solutions often combine components from multiple manufacturers.
2. Regulatory Fluency: Can they cite specific IRS code sections for investment tax credits (ITC) or EPA regulations affecting your industry?
3. Performance Guarantees: Partners worth their salt will stake compensation on meeting energy savings targets. If they won't put skin in the game, walk away.

Future-Proofing Through Modular Design
Let's say you install solar today. What happens when perovskite cells hit commercial viability next year? Smart partners design systems with upgrade pathways – none of that "rip and replace" nonsense. I'm still haunted by a 2019 hospital project where inflexible inverters forced $1.2 million in premature upgrades. Ouch.
